In the event of an exit from the EU without an agreement by the United Kingdom on 12 April next, customs will be one of the main sectors concerned. A few days before the deadline, Wednesday 3 April, the European Commission wanted to recall all the preparations made in this field (see EUROPE B12136A10) and especially the various consequences.
